## Break-Glass Access: Quillfen Cache Postmortem

During the stale-cache incident on the Marrowgate plugin host, external authors could not invalidate entries after TTL drift. The fix shipped in Quillfen 4.2. If the invalidation endpoint is unresponsive and you must purge via the break-glass console, authenticate with the recovery passphrase shown immediately below.

unlock words, kagef-taduf: fenir-quenix-norwyn-sorvan-gormir-gorir-fraok

Runbook: Paritylens rate checker. Welcome aboard! The crawler compares our hotel rates against partner feeds every four hours. If the mismatch alert fires, first check whether a partner feed is stale — nine times out of ten that's it, not a real parity breach. Stale feeds older than 24 hours auto-suppress. Only escalate genuine undercuts on live inventory. Feed freshness and the escalation checklist are on the internal page here.

operations page: https://jenkins.zemvarcloud.local/job/merge_requests/repo/build/73930b4b30f0a8ed

**Holiday hours — read before arriving.** Between 23 Dec and 2 Jan, the Bramblewick site runs reduced hours: doors open 08:00–16:00 only, no weekend access. Contractors must sign in at the east lobby; the main entrance is locked throughout. Deliveries go to the loading dock before 14:00. Heating is on a holiday schedule, so dress accordingly. If you arrive before the concierge, you'll need the temporary door code to get through the east lobby, which is as follows:

door code, yagap-bahof: bdg-O-05